ORTEC’s Sales Order Optimization Solution provides SCA Americas with capability to increase sales, enhance customer service, reduce transportation costs and improve warehouse productivity

Published on November 6, 2007

SCA

ORTEC and SCA Americas announced that SCA has gone live with ORTEC’s solution for Sales Order Optimization in their North American Tissue division.

Like most CPG manufacturers, SCA provides incentives for their customers to place orders in Full Truckload (FTL) quantities based on the ‘cube’ size of the order. According to Mike Jansen, Vice President of Supply Chain Management for SCA Tissue, “This strategy poses a variety of challenges due to our diverse product mix and complex customer requirements. Historically, ‘cube’ limits for FTL orders have been set low to avoid loading issues at the warehouse. As a result, opportunities are missed to increase the order size and transportation costs are higher due to under utilized transportation units.”

SCA joins a growing list of top companies by utilizing ORTEC’s 3-D pallet and load optimization technology at the sales order level within SAP. The solution leverages industry standards along with the customer requirements needed to increase order size while providing warehouse personnel the means to execute the order. SCA Customer Service Representatives now have comprehensive visibility to orders and are able to prioritize and make tactical decisions based on customer agreements and feedback. These combined benefits cannot be accomplished with standard ERP-TMS-WMS configurations.

With ORTEC’s solution in place, SCA is realizing immediate benefits. “We have seen significant value from day one. In the short time since implementation, we have already increased the size of our FTL orders by an average of approximately two full pallets”, said Jansen.

About SCA

SCA Tissue North America is a leading manufacturer of sanitary paper in North America with annual sales of $1 billion. SCA Tissue is headquartered in Philadelphia, PA and has plants and offices in Neenah and Menasha, WI; South Glens Falls and Greenwich, NY; Barton, AL; Flagstaff and Bellemont, AZ; and Alsip, IL. SCA Tissue NA is a division of SCA Americas and is owned by SCA, a global consumer goods and paper company with headquarters in Stockholm, Sweden. Internationally, SCA produces tissue, packaging solutions, publication papers and solid wood products. Additionally, SCA manufactures and distributes personal care products such as Serenity ™ and TENA ™. SCA conducts business in 50 countries, employs 50,000 people and has annual sales of $13.8 billion.
